Bavarian Machinery Works has an illustrious corporate history stretching back to G.R. 1917, when it was founded from the ashes of a restructured airplane manufacturer. A year later, it began its signature motorcycle and car manufacturing division. Since then, BMW has worked unceasingly to meet Bavaria's demand for high-quality engines in both the civilian and military sectors.
Most minifigs in the Nehellium Galaxy are familiar with BMW's luxury hovercars. Built with high-quality materials, design, and teknology, BMW hovercars can achieve speeds, handling, and clean turns other hovercar brands can only dream of. Their popularity is such that the Space Mafia makes a handsome profit smuggling them past economic sanctions into NATO countries, especially Trattoria.
BMW also possesses a substantial military manufacturing division. Noted for its constant innovation, BMW's spacecraft design division is responsible for the cutting edge in Bavarian starfighters and bombers. In addition to typical rocket engines, BMW also developed an advanced anti-gravity drive that allows Bavarian fighters, such as its BMW-263 frame, unlimited maneuverability and significant evasive ability in dogfights.
BMW has earned distinctions as the most sustainable hovercar company for its initiatives in reducing factory pollution and incorporating more efficient propulsion in its hovercars by abandoning space oil.
